Sveti Petar

by Discover Montenegro

Church of Sveti Petar, in Bijelo Polje was built in 1190. It is the location of composition of the UNESCO Miroslav’s Gospel of Miroslav. It is one of the oldest surviving documents written in Old Church Slavonic, along with the Chronicle of the Priest of Duklja. Miroslav Gospels manuscript represents the most precious and significant document in cultural heritage of Serbia. It was created by order by Miroslav, brother of Stefan Nemanja, Grand Prince of Serbian medievel state Rascia.
